Formula 1 Debut: Antonelli Returns to Fourth Position Following Successful Penalty Appeal at Australian Grand Prix

2025 Australian Grand Prix, Thursday - Giacomo Crapanzano

In a surprising turn of events, the Australian Grand Prix witnessed the reinstatement of Andrea Kimi Antonelli to fourth position in his Formula 1 debut, following a successful appeal by Mercedes against a previously imposed five-second penalty.

The penalty, initially issued for an unsafe release, had seemingly knocked Antonelli down to fifth place. However, the Mercedes team challenged this decision, and their appeal resulted in a comprehensive review of the incident.

The key evidence in this case was the roll-hoop camera footage, which provided a clear view of the incident. Upon careful examination, it was determined that Antonelli, the Italian debutant, did not interfere with Nico Hulkenberg’s race.
